Job Summary

W e are seeking a skilled Manufacturing Technician to join our team. In this role, you will support the transition from development to production, perform mechanical assembly and testing, and operate precision equipment including manual lathes. The ideal candidate will have strong m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and the ability to work in a dynamic team environment with changing priorities.

 

Job Description

  • Support the transition of products from development to full-scale production.
  • Manufacture, assemble, and test mechanical components per written procedures, engineering drawings, models, and specifications.
  • Collaborate with production leads, supervisors, managers, and QA inspectors to ensure timely delivery to customers.
  • Troubleshoot, diagnose, and correct mechanical issues through rework, repair, and maintenance.
  • Conduct root cause analysis and implement corrective actions to prevent recurrence.
  • Set up and operate precision-calibrated tools and equipment, including manual lathes and measurement gauges.
  • Identify and implement safety and efficiency improvements within the production area.
  • Perform routine maintenance and cleaning of lathes and workspaces.
  • Support additional tasks as assigned to contribute to organizational success.
  • Shift time: 07:00 am - 15:30 pm M-F - with overtime and weekend hours as needed

 

S kills Required

  • 3–5 years of hands-on experience in industrial manufacturing, mechanical integration, or a related field.
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ering models, technical drawings, specifications, and work instructions.
  • Strong mechanical aptitude with hand dexterity for assembling small components.
  • Basic math and computer skills (Windows OS, Microsoft Office).
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Able to perform physically demanding tasks, including repetitive motion and lifting up to 44 lbs.
  • Willingness to work overtime, weekends, and off-shift hours when needed.
  • Must be a U.S. citizen, permanent resident (Green Card holder), or otherwise lawfully authorized to work in the U.S.
  • Experience with Lathes, Manual machining, CNC machining
